Insider Activity in Aggregate Can Be a Signal on Its Own

Insider activity is typically characterized by insiders selling more than they buy. However, when insiders start buying more than they sell, it's a positive signal. During the pandemic, insiders were buying stocks at a higher rate than selling, which was a rare and extreme bullish signal. Paying attention to the aggregate buying and selling can provide interesting insights.
